Yang, Fred wrote: We are in process of rebase to the latest code, and will start merging both paravirtualization and VT designs base on our previous email threads. One of the problems with rebasing to the latest bk tree is that it's not possible to rebase by just doing a bk pull and dealing with the conflicts. Checking in all patched Linux files (we called it "flattening") should hopefully make that process easier.
Here's what I was thinking:
cp_patch ()
{
# maintainer does this periodically
#diff -u $LINUX/$1 $XEN/$2 > $LINUXPATCH/$3
# maintainer does this to rebase to upstream linux
#cp $LINUX/$1 $XEN/$2
#patch <$LINUXPATCH/$3 $XEN/$2
# Most normal users and developers
true;
}
We're currently based on:
ChangeSet@xxxxxx, 2005-04-26 16:24:29-06:00, djm@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
Oops, forgot a patch file
md5key:
2005/04/26 16:24:29 1.1334 426ebf9dElmn-4PJcDb_JoGYAMuVlA
One possibility is to reapply all the changes after this changeset into
the flattened tree. Any other suggestions?
